Dogecoin Price Resistance Analysis
Based on the most recent statistics, Dogecoin is trading at about $0.179, down somewhat 1.3% over the past 24 hours. This price activity implies DOGE is having trouble making notable changes in either direction. However, a strong community and broad acceptance of support help, and resistance levels that stop significant upward movement have greatly affected the price of Dogecoin.
Analyses now point to a notable resistance zone for DOGE at about the $0.331 and $0.351 levels. For the cryptocurrency in recent weeks, this zone has shown to be a significant obstacle since the price fails to rise beyond it even after several tries. Should DOGE be able to overcome these resistance levels, it would indicate a possible breakout, thereby driving the price to higher levels, say $0.376 or even $0.40 in the medium run. DOGE may find it difficult to maintain its present price or might even drop lower if it keeps being rejected at these levels, though.
Dogecoin’s performance recently also shows itself as below numerous important moving averages. Currently trading below its 20, 50, 100, and 200-day exponential moving averages (EMAs), DOGE usually points to a bearish short-term future. Notwithstanding these difficulties, some Dogecoin enthusiasts remain optimists based on the past performance of the currency, particularly in December. With an average development rate of 22.2%, December has usually been an excellent month for Dogecoin during the past ten years. This December has been an outlier, though, with DOGE down 23%, casting questions about whether it will recover as it has in other years.

Crypto Presale Risks
Though it comes with certain dangers, investing in crypto presales can be rather profitable. Although presales have great potential for returns, they are sometimes more erratic and less controlled than more well-known cryptocurrencies like Dogecoin. Investing in a presale requires careful study of the idea, its application, its team, and its path map.
The promise of significant returns makes emerging cryptocurrencies tempting, but investors have to be careful of ventures with dubious objectives and fraud. While social media channels like Telegram and X (previously Twitter) can give essential updates from developers and the community, platforms like CoinMarketCap and CoinGecko provide insightful analysis of new cryptocurrencies. Still, it’s important to guarantee the presale is real and the idea has a strong basis for expansion.
